Palm-sized Mini PC HTNJ08C ST11-M Education Computer Lab: Customer Case Study

2026-07-22

📱 Palm-sized miniPC and HTNJ08C Rugged Tablet Transform Education Computer Labs

Last month, a school IT administrator shared a common frustration: students at the back of computer labs consistently missed assignment instructions. After deploying a Mini PC solution featuring the Palm-sized miniPC, HTNJ08C Rugged Tablet, and ST11-M, the outcome was remarkable. Let us walk through what changed.

The transition began when the school district recognized that their aging desktop infrastructure could no longer support modern educational software. Teachers reported that boot times exceeded five minutes, and students often lost work due to system crashes. The IT team needed a solution that could deliver reliable performance across dozens of workstations without requiring a complete rewiring of the computer lab. They turned to an industrial solution for Education that promised compact design and enterprise-grade durability.

The deployment centered on three complementary devices that worked together to create a seamless learning environment. The Palm-sized miniPC served as the primary workstation for student desks, while the HTNJ08C Rugged Tablet became the teacher's mobile command center. The ST11-M was deployed as a versatile station for group projects and specialized software training. This combination allowed the school to maximize their existing desk space while providing students with access to powerful computing resources.

Solution Benefits and Key Outcomes

The key benefits of the Palm-sized miniPC, HTNJ08C Rugged Tablet, and ST11-M for Education extend beyond basic computing power. The Palm-sized miniPC, measuring just 7.4 x 7.4 x 3.3 cm, eliminated the need for bulky towers under student desks. This freed up legroom and improved classroom airflow, reducing the ambient temperature in the computer lab by an average of 3 degrees Celsius. Teachers reported that students were more focused and less distracted by equipment noise, as the fanless design of the miniPC operated silently.

The HTNJ08C Rugged Tablet provided the teacher with a portable solution for monitoring student progress. With its 8-inch sunlight-readable display and IP67 rating, the tablet could survive accidental drops and spills that are common in active classrooms. The school IT administrator noted a 60% reduction in support tickets related to teacher equipment failures after deploying the HTNJ08C Rugged Tablet. Teachers could walk around the lab, provide real-time feedback, and project their screen to the main display without returning to a fixed workstation.

Organizations consistently report improved student engagement scores, reduced staff overtime from equipment troubleshooting, lower total cost of ownership compared to older systems, and the flexibility to scale operations as enrollment grows. The school's IT department calculated that the three-device solution reduced annual maintenance costs by 45% compared to their previous desktop fleet, primarily because the solid-state storage and ruggedized components required fewer replacements.

The ST11-M played a critical role in this transformation. This 10.1-inch rugged tablet served as a shared device for collaborative learning activities. Students used it for coding exercises, digital art projects, and science simulations that required more screen real estate than the miniPC setup provided. The 10.1 windows(ST11-M)Rugged Industrial Tablet featured a hot-swappable battery system that kept the device running through six consecutive class periods without needing a recharge station. This eliminated the common problem of dead tablets during afternoon sessions.

Market Pain Points and Challenges

Customers deploying equipment for Education consistently report that reliability is their number one concern. System crashes during critical moments, bulky devices that irritate students, and complex setup procedures create friction that undermines the entire learning experience. The school's previous setup required students to log in to network drives that frequently timed out, causing lost work and frustrated learners. The Palm-sized miniPC addressed this by providing local storage and instant-on capability, so students could begin working within 15 seconds of powering on the device.

Another significant challenge was the physical strain of traditional computer labs. Standard desktop towers occupied valuable desk space, forcing students to work in cramped conditions. The miniPCs could be mounted behind monitors or under desks using VESA brackets, freeing up 70% of the desk surface for books, notebooks, and other learning materials. Teachers observed that students in the redesigned lab maintained better posture and reported fewer complaints about neck and eye strain.

The IT administrator also highlighted the importance of device management. The school deployed a centralized management system that allowed them to push software updates and security patches to all devices simultaneously. This reduced the time spent on maintenance from 12 hours per week to just 2 hours. The rugged design of all three devices meant that accidental damage claims dropped by 80% in the first semester alone.
